for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   Библиотеки (http://forum.boolean.name/forumdisplay.php?f=28)
-   -   Secure Packer 1.0 Beta (http://forum.boolean.name/showthread.php?t=8773)

-=Jack=- 26.07.2009 19:16

Secure Packer 1.0 Beta
 
Вложений: 4
Secure Packer - программа для запаковки множества ресурсов в один файл и распаковки
их в реальном времени при выполнении программы. Secure Packer также поддерживает шиф-
рование данных. До версии 3.0 программа называлась Jack Packer.

История версий:

Secure Packer 1.0: Улучшен алгоритм шифрования данных.
Добавлена возможность строить независимую виртуальную иерархию каталогов.
Добавлена возможность перетаскивать файлы прямо из окна проводника Windows.
Добавлена возможность распаковки в отдельном потоке.
Упаковщик переписан на .NET 2.0.
Добавлен распаковщик.

Jack Packer 2.0: Исправлен основной недостаток первой версии: отсутствие вложенных каталогов.
Улучшен интерфейс.
Появилась возможность создавать архивы без шифрования для улучшения быстродействия.

Jack Packer 1.0: Первая рабочая версия. Содержит всего две команды: EnterPak и LeavePak. Каталоги не поддерживаются.

Как пользоваться?
Пакет программы состоит из трёх частей:
1. Packer
Интерфейс программы-пакера интуитивно понятен и не требует детального рассмотрения
(если конечно Вы не тупой дегенерат). В окне имеются список файлов и папок, которые
вы можете добавить в архив(при добавлении папки в архив добавляется всё ее содержимое
включяя подпапки). После добавления вы можете сохранить архив в файл с расширением,
которое задаете вручную. Добавлять файлы и папки можно также перетаскивая их прямо
из окна проводника Windows, Total Commander'а и других файловых менеджеров.
2. Unpacker
Интерфейс распаковщика также интуитивно понятен. Стоит отметить, что если пак
зашифрован, Вы сможете посмотреть список файлов, и даже распаковать их, но в результате
Вы не получите оригинального содержимого упакованых файлов.
3. Библиотека для Real-time распаковки
В Jack Packer 1 и 2 в библиотеке было всего две функции - EnterPack и LeavePack. В secure
Packer были добавлены ещё тринадцать функций - EnterPackedDir, StartEnteringPack,
StartEnteringPackedDir, EnteredPack, EnteredPackedDir, CancelEnteringPack,
CancelEnteringPackedDir, GetEnteringProgress, EndEnteringPack, EndEnteringPackedDir,
LeavePackedDir, GetPackedFile и ReleasePackedFiles. Подробную информацию по всем функциям
можно получить прямо в меню справки Blitz3D, или нажимая F1 на нужной функции в Blitz3D IDE.

В приложении несколько скриншотов упаковщика и разпаковщика.

Скачать можно на моём сайте в разделе загрузок.

Unodeya 26.07.2009 19:20

Ответ: Secure Packer 1.0 Beta
 
ИМХО = Лучший пакер! Качать Всем! 100%ый лидер.

SBJoker 26.07.2009 19:32

Ответ: Secure Packer 1.0 Beta
 
1. Оно в память распаковывает?
2. Оно только для Блитз3Д или есть варианты?

-=Jack=- 26.07.2009 19:41

Ответ: Secure Packer 1.0 Beta
 
Цитата:

Сообщение от SBJoker (Сообщение 111922)
1. Оно в память распаковывает?
2. Оно только для Блитз3Д или есть варианты?

1. Нет, в папку, в глубине системы. Блицом из памяти много не прочитаешь <_<. Да и если говорить о краже ресурсов, то стянуть их из памяти не сложнее чем с папки..
2. Пока только блиц.

NitE 26.07.2009 21:11

Ответ: Secure Packer 1.0 Beta
 
ага, именно поэтому пока пользуемся MoleBoxом

impersonalis 26.07.2009 22:03

Ответ: Secure Packer 1.0 Beta
 
Цитата:

Блицом из памяти много не прочитаешь
Вот не нада
модели
и картинки можно самому написать загрузчик.
Да и с видео тоже пошаманить

-=Jack=- 26.07.2009 22:45

Ответ: Secure Packer 1.0 Beta
 
Цитата:

Сообщение от impersonalis (Сообщение 111946)
Вот не нада
модели
и картинки можно самому написать загрузчик.
Да и с видео тоже пошаманить

Легко говорить :-D

impersonalis 26.07.2009 23:06

Ответ: Secure Packer 1.0 Beta
 
Цитата:

Сообщение от -=Jack=- (Сообщение 111951)
Легко говорить :-D

Взялся за гуж - не говори, что не дюж
http://forum.boolean.name/showthread.php?t=5745

-=Jack=- 26.07.2009 23:36

Ответ: Secure Packer 1.0 Beta
 
Ну, картинку в BMP загрузить то можно, а вот другие форматы и меши, особенно с анимацией...
Я не вижу особого смысла распаковывать в память, а не на диск..

impersonalis 27.07.2009 00:36

Ответ: Secure Packer 1.0 Beta
 
Ну просто тогда - серьёзный конкурент тебе:
http://www.sodaware.net/dev/blitz/libs/blitz.zipapi/

SBJoker 27.07.2009 01:18

Ответ: Secure Packer 1.0 Beta
 
Для блитз3д много кто делал пакеры, например тов.Maxus делал просто потрясный пакер но потом забил.

А так, в BlitzMAX любой может себе написать пакер сам, с цтением прям из архива без всяких сохранений на винт.

Maxus 12.04.2013 19:28

Ответ: Secure Packer 1.0 Beta
 
Ну почему сразу забил, просто в тени разрабатывал версию 2, она кстати использовалась в неких проектах. Там прямое чтение из памяти. Работает не только с блитз, Хорс.

DeN_93 17.04.2013 17:17

Ответ: Secure Packer 1.0 Beta
 
Скачал пакер, запускаю, выдаёт ошибку: Windows 7 x64

Arton 17.04.2013 22:27

Ответ: Secure Packer 1.0 Beta
 
Цитата:

Сообщение от DeN_93 (Сообщение 257186)
Скачал пакер, запускаю, выдаёт ошибку: Windows 7 x64

Попробуй это использовать, распаковывает сразу в память - PackB3D, даю ссылку сразу на тред.


Часовой пояс GMT +4, время: 01:20.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ot